Forkk, you derped somewhere in the auto-update part: Force-update gets me to the newest version (apparently #7 atm), but then auto-update wants to "upgrade" to #4.
Edit: I see that the current adfly download is still #4 as well, so I guess auto-update only considers "official" releases and force-update also considers dev builds?
Forkk, you derped somewhere in the auto-update part: Force-update gets me to the newest version (apparently #7 atm), but then auto-update wants to "upgrade" to #4.
Probably because it's set to upgrade to the newest "stable" build, which is 4. #7 is a dev build. Fresh off the presses in fact.

Hi, I've occasionally tried out MultiMC, but keep returning to the old multicraft. Is there any chance I can get a couple of feature request which will make MultiMC that little bit more powerful?
Firstly - Add 'servers.dat' to the list of files included in a config pack..
I often create a patch set (effectively a config pack) and a matching server.
I send the patch set (including the mods.. I can't understand your problem with bundling everything needed, especially when they are free to download as it is.. another day maybe), *including* a servers.dat so the client already knows how to connect to the matching server.
Secondly - Add the ability to save multiple login details, and record the default used with each instance.
My Multicraft (hopefully one day multiMC) is stored on a central server. Each person brings their own laptop and is given a shortcut which launches a central multicraft. They can all see every instance, and run the ones they are told to. (Think classroom of 8-10 yr olds at computer club during lunch!)
I currently copy 'lastlogin' files around (as unpleasant as it sounds) so the kids get unique server logins without having to know the passwords.
This allows me to create a world, a server, and a set of clients with pre-canned logins. Then have the kids turn up, launch multicraft and get straight into gaming without ever needing to change their school laptops. (Yes, 8 yr old school kids have windows laptops..)..
